RAL 620-5 vs RAL 640-1
Side-by-side comparison of RAL 620-5 and RAL 640-1. Click on a color to view its full details page.
Color Comparison
With a Delta E of 36.4, these colors are very different. Both colors belong to the Blue hue family. RAL 620-5 has a neutral temperature while RAL 640-1 has a cool temperature. RAL 640-1 is brighter with an LRV of 29.5 compared to 3.3 for RAL 620-5. Both colors have similar saturation levels.
